Glossitis is the inflammation of the tongue, causing it to become red, swollen, smooth, and often painful. The surface may lose its normal texture (papillae), making the tongue appear glossy. Eating, drinking, or speaking can become uncomfortable. It can be a sign of nutritional deficiency, infection, irritation, or an allergic reaction. Causes
Glossitis can occur due to several factors, including:
- Vitamin B12, folic acid, or iron deficiency
- Hot, spicy foods, tobacco, or alcohol can cause irritation
- Mouth infections (bacterial, viral, or fungal)
- Allergic reaction to toothpaste, mouthwash, or dental materials
- Dry mouth (xerostomia) or dehydration
- Autoimmune diseases (like lichen planus)
- Hormonal or metabolic disorders (like diabetes)
Symptoms – What It Means for Your Body
Symptom | Explanation |
Swollen, red, or smooth tongue | Inflammation or loss of tongue papillae |
Burning or tenderness | Irritation of taste buds and nerve endings |
Difficulty in chewing or speaking | Pain or swelling restricting tongue movement |
Cracks or fissures on the surface | Nutritional deficiency or chronic irritation |
Loss of taste or altered taste | Affected taste buds and mucosal cells |
Lifestyle & Care Tips
- Maintain good oral hygiene; brush gently and rinse your mouth after every meal.
- Avoid spicy, acidic, or very hot foods.
- Quit smoking and alcohol, which aggravate inflammation.
- Drink plenty of water to prevent dryness.
- Include vitamin B12, iron, and folate-rich foods like spinach, beetroot, lentils, eggs, and nuts.
